Налаштування SPICE-консолі віртуальних машин в OpenStack

Ця стаття буде цікава адміністраторам хмарної платформи OpenStack. Мова піде про відображення консолі віртуальних машин в дашборде. Справа в тому, що за замовчуванням в OpenStack використовується noVNC консоль, яка з прийнятною швидкістю працює в рамках локальної мережі, але погано підходить для роботи з виртуалками, запущеними у віддаленому датацентрі. У цьому випадку чуйність консолі, м'яко кажучи, пригнічує.
У даній статті мова піде про те, як налаштувати в своїй інсталяції Опенстека набагато більш швидку SPICE-консоль.

Читати далі →

Docker: коли потрібно розміщувати контейнер на віртуальній машині?

image

Контейнери додатків гарантують високу швидкість роботи і утилізацію ресурсів, але їм не вистачає тієї безпеки, яку забезпечують віртуальні машини. Тому сьогодні хочеться поговорити про використання Docker всередині ВМ, зокрема – OpenSource проекту QEMU/KVM.

Читати далі →

Миттєвий запуск майже будь OS під Linux використовуючи libvirt + qemu

По ходу роботи над CoreOS і Kubernetes мені доводилося часто відтворювати оточення користувачів, щоб допомогти їм вирішити проблему. Погодьтеся, що при запуску OS за допомогою контейнера, не завжди можна добитися повного функціоналу OS, т. к. часто доводилося вирішувати питання, пов'язані з systemd.
Так і народилася ідея написати милиці, які з легкістю допоможуть мені підняти кластер з майже будь оперционной системи, такий собі OpenStack в мініатюрі. Зараз в якості гостьових повністю підтримуються наступні OS:
  • Ubuntu
  • Debian
  • CentOS 6/7 + atomic
  • Fedora + atomic
  • CoreOS
Частково:
  • FreeBSD (потрібно налаштування мережі та ключів ssh)
  • openSUSE (потрібне ручне налаштування мережі та ключів ssh)
  • Windows (консоль не потрапиш, але за допомогою virt-manager можна користуватися графічним інтерфейсом
посприяв Публікації колега, який випадково побачив, як я тестую код. А тепер про переваги перед Vagrant. Перша перевага — час. Наприклад, три віртуальні машини створюються всього за 20-30 секунд.
image
Читати далі →

Hyper-V, або KVM?

Технологія віртуалізації серверів зі своєї більш ніж тридцятирічної історією сьогодні стала однією з ключових в ІТ, лягла в основу хмарних обчислень і сервісів нового покоління. Компанії, що обирають платформу для VPS або впровадження віртуалізації у своєї ІТ-інфраструктури, поряд з продуктами VMware розглядають в якості альтернативи рішення на основі інших гіпервізора, насамперед Microsoft Hyper-V і розробленого в рамках Open Source гіпервізора KVM.

Різноманітність засобів віртуалізації змушує задуматися: що саме вибрати? Це може виявитися непростим завданням. Наприклад, прихильники Xen вважають її надійної і гнучкої платформою з гарним набором інструментів управління. Любителі Hyper-V і KVM приведуть вагомі аргументи на користь цих рішень і надсилає їх гідності.



Читати далі →

VDS/VPS: від хостингу до хмар

Історія хостингу пов'язана з розвитком інтернету. У 90-х роках у різних країнах стали з'являтися провайдери, що спеціалізуються на послугах розміщення сайтів у великій кількості. В якості операційних систем для сервера хостингу зазвичай використовувалися надійні і доступні дистрибутиви Linux.

image
Технологія віртуалізації, розроблена для мейнфреймів IBM ще в 80-х, виявилася дуже до речі і на інших платформах. З'явилися програмні засоби віртуалізації – Parallels Virtuozzo, OpenVZ, VMware ESX, Microsoft Hyper-V, XenSource, Xen, KVM, HyperVM, FreeVPS, FreeBSD Jail, VDSManager, Solaris Zones.

Читати далі →

Стієчний KVM для економних

Завдяки нашому ОпСоСу (оператору стільникового зв'язку), що поставило до нас в офіс 2G/3G базову станцію, у нас нарешті зробилася нормальна зв'язок. Крім того, разом зі станцією ми знайшли нову стійку. Була домовленість, що в цю стійку ми перекинемо ще й своє обладнання, тому що місця було небагато і третя стійка сильно заважала. І якщо серверне залізо помістилося без проблем, то прилаштувати монітор було важко. У стійці залишалося десь 5U вільного місця, що для полиці з монітором недостатньо.

Взагалі-то, ми дуже любимо стійкові KVM — максимум функціоналу при 1U розміру, але абсолютно не подобаються ціни. 80 тис. руб за те, що нас би влаштувала.

А що якщо понищебродить спробувати зробити щось подібне самостійно? Після перевірки складу, ми виявили, що:


Читати далі →

SDS від NetApp: ONTAP Select

ONTAP Select це логічний розвиток лінійки Data ONTAP-v

Як і попередник, цей продукт живе і повністю спирається на традиційний RAID контролер, встановлений у вашому сервері. Також відсутня підтримка FCP. Підтримуються NAS (CIFS, NFS) та IP SAN (iSCSI) протоколи.

З очікуваних нововведень:
  • Підтримка High Avalability
  • Підтримка кластеризації до 4 нод
  • Максимальний корисний об'єм 400 ТБ (за 100ТБ на ноду в 4х нодовом кластері)
На ряду з High Avalability і кластеризацией як і раніше підтримуються однонодовые конфігурації.


Читати далі →

Акція «Літо KVM» — Віртуальний сервер на Linux

Ми вирішили організувати акцію на два виду наших найпотужніших віртуальних серверів на Linux. При підключенні сервера на один місяць, з 14 червня по 1 серпня, залишок підписки до кінця календарного літа ви отримуєте в подарунок.

Наприклад, при підключенні до сервера сьогодні, ще півтора місяці хостингу, ви отримуєте безкоштовно.

image


Читати далі →

Будуємо своє власне надійне хмару на базі OpenNebula з Ceph, MariaDB Galera Cluster і OpenvSwitch



На цей раз я б хотів розповісти, як налаштувати цей сабж, в часності кожен окремий компонент, що б у підсумку отримати своє власне, розширюване, отказоустойчеавое хмару на базі OpenNebula. У даній статті я розгляну наступні моменти:

Теми самі по собі дуже цікаві, так що навіть якщо вас не цікавить кінцева мета, але цікавить налаштування якого-небудь окремого компонента. Ласкаво прошу під кат.


Читати далі →

Як встановити Nutanix CE під VMware ESXi



Після запуску нашого Nutanix Community Edition, безкоштовної, «софтової» версії Nutanix, яке може встановлюватися на довільне, користувальницьке «залізо», мені часто доводилося відповідати на питання: «А що робити, якщо у нас немає відповідного фізичного сервера? Можна поставити його як „віртуальний апплаенс“, всередині гіпервізора, на віртуальну машину?»

Влітку розробники зібрали версію, яка навчилася працювати в режимі nested virtualization, тобто виртуалка CVM, що працює в гипервизоре KVM, який, у свою чергу, працює в гипервизоре VMware ESXi, і цей останній якраз і емулює для нашого гіпервізора потрібне «залізо».

Ось як це можна зробити:

Читати далі →